Ideal for undergraduate students in philosophy and science studies, Philosophy of Technology offers an engaging and comprehensive overview of a subject vital to our time. * An up-to-date, accessible overview of the philosophy of technology, defining technology and its characteristics. * Explores the issues that arise as technology becomes an integral part of our society. * In addition to traditional topics in science and technology studies, the volume offers discussion of technocracy, the romantic rebellion against technology. * Complements The Philosophy of Technology: The Technological Condition: An Anthology, edited by Robert C. Scharff and Val Dusek (Blackwell, 2003).
